Output 85c620858d0190078ac7ebd23fe8ec75e8a778bb8d60dd4c74833f25505cee14:11

value
601665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df0ac9fcc12a55ee3aa3f6466d9a11a6aa6a2925 OP_EQUAL
address
3N2MXxPEQevHC73jKWkPaWTcnAASNyEC3j
transaction
85c620858d0190078ac7ebd23fe8ec75e8a778bb8d60dd4c74833f25505cee14
spent
true